A Prime Number

A prime number is a positive integer that is divisible only by itself and one.

Five thousand and three is the 670th prime number.   See primes in Base 2 Binary

Not A Composite

Composites have more than just these two factors.

Five Thousand and Three is not a composite number because it has exactly two factors: One and Five Thousand and Three
